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team arrives quickly to assess the damage and contain the water to prevent further spreading. We use specialized equipment to extract water and prevent further damage. This step is critical to preventing further damage and ensuring a smooth cleanup process.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use industrial-grade pumps and wet vacuums to extract water from your property, including floors, walls, and carpets. Our equipment is designed to remove water quickly and efficiently, reducing the risk of further damage. This step can take anywhere from 30 minutes to several hours, depending on the severity of the dam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, our team uses specialized drying equipment to remove excess moisture from your property. This includes dehumidifiers, fans, and other equipment designed to speed up the drying process. This step can take several days to complete, depending on the size of your property and the severity of the damage.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
With the water removed and your property dry, our team begins the cleaning and sanitizing process. This includes cleaning and disinfecting all affected areas, including floors, walls, and surfaces. This step is crucial to preventing the growth of mold and mildew.

Sink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ak with minimal water damage | Yes | No | DIY cleanup is usually enough for small leaks with minimal damage. |
| Large leak with significant water damage |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ary for large leaks with significant damage to prevent further damage and ensure a smooth cleanup process. |
| Water damage to electrical systems |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ary for water damage to electrical systems to prevent electrical shock and ensure a safe cleanup process. |
| Water damage to structural elements |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ary for water damage to structural elements to prevent further damage and ensure a safe cleanup process. |
| Musty odors or mold growth |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ary for musty odors or mold growth to prevent further damage and ensure a safe cleanup process. |
| Water damage to valuables or irreplaceable items |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ary for water damage to valuables or irreplaceable items to prevent further damage and ensure a safe cleanup process. |
